Form 4: Bridgewater Bancshares EVP Sells Shares Under 10b5-1 Plan

Sentiment:

Insider Transaction Report


Bridgewater Bancshares' EVP & Chief Strategy Officer, Mary Jayne Crocker, sold a total of 10,646 shares of common stock in late August 2025.

Summary

  • Mary Jayne Crocker, EVP & Chief Strategy Officer of Bridgewater Bancshares, Inc. (BWB), reported sales of common stock.
  • On August 25, 2025, 1,332 shares were sold at a weighted average price of $16.2277 per share, with prices ranging from $16.20 to $16.305.
  • On August 26, 2025, an additional 9,314 shares were sold at a price of $16.05 per share.
  • Following these transactions, Mary Jayne Crocker beneficially owns 192,339 shares of Bridgewater Bancshares common stock.
  • The transactions were made pursuant to a Rule 10b5-1(c) plan, indicating they were pre-scheduled.

Industry Context

Insider sales are a routine part of executive compensation and personal financial planning, especially when executed under a Rule 10b5-1 plan. In the banking sector, such transactions are common and generally do not signal specific industry-wide trends unless they are widespread across multiple institutions or involve unusually large volumes relative to the insider's holdings.
